Abstract

An integrated reforming and power generation process is provided. This process employs a steam methane reformer to provide a hot process gas stream and a flue gas stream, utilizes the hot process gas stream to provide heat to produce a total steam stream comprising a process steam stream and an excess steam stream, and utilizes the flue gas stream to provide heat to at least a pre-reformer mixture stream, a reformer feed stream, the process steam stream and a pre-reformer steam stream The flue gas stream also provides heat to an integrated power generation process, and the excess steam stream is less than 15% of the total steam stream.
